Pain control: Probably will get very little relief from topical anesthetic, and it will wear off very quickly. Topical works by (key word) blocking pain pathways, but wears off very rapidly. Would be better to treat the cause. Discuss antibiotic therapy with the treating General Dentist or Oral Surgeon that will be doing the surgery.

DANGEROUS!: I'm very sorry to hear about your son. Considering the type of medications he is taking, he is in a compromised condition prior to getting his teeth removed. Many precautions are needed, and communication between his doctor and dentist. Please contact them to ensure he gets the proper solution for his infection. If a patient has uncontrolled diabetes, for instance, dental infection can be fatal.
